This seems to have introduced a regression. I am seeing ICE while
building TSVC_2 for AARCH64
with -O3 -flto -mcpu=neoverse-v2 -msve-vector-bits=128

tsvc.c: In function 's331':
tsvc.c:2744:8: internal compiler error: Segmentation fault
 2744 | real_t s331(struct args_t * func_args)
      |        ^
